Transaction 51c993d24d5f3423f6fb8803cb5149001e2057630e2c5a5b11bc53dde91f6523

1 Input
2 Outputs
  • 51c993d24d5f3423f6fb8803cb5149001e2057630e2c5a5b11bc53dde91f6523:0
  • value  295000
    address  15bZFjsDs8yomexioSV8FRRvkmU7QskGec
  • 51c993d24d5f3423f6fb8803cb5149001e2057630e2c5a5b11bc53dde91f6523:1
  • value  5704160
    address  3QVwpYHMgggnP5StpBxbPuqKpd8sSA3RXa